Life
Develop an interest in life as you see it; the people, things, literature, music - the world is so rich, simply throbbing with rich treasures, beautiful souls and interesting people. Forget yourself.
- Henry Miller
Life doesn't make any sense, and we all pretend it does. Comedy's job is to point out that it doesn't make sense, and that it doesn't make much difference anyway.
- Eric Idle
Learning is retained through putting into practice; family prestige is maintained through good behavior; a respectable person is recognised by his excellent qualities; and anger is seen in the eyes.
- Chanakya
The aim of life is to live, and to live means to be aware. Joyously, drunkenly, serenely, divinely aware.
- Henry Miller
Die while you’re alive and be absolutely dead. Then do whatever you want: it’s all good.
- Anonymous
Be like a tree. The tree gives shade even to him who cuts off its boughs.
- Sri Chaitanya
Sing your life; any fool can think of words that rhyme.
- Morrissey
Life is like a beautiful melody, only the lyrics are messed up.
- Hans Christian Anderson
A life spent making mistakes is not only more honourable, but more useful than a life spent doing nothing.
- George Bernard Shaw
You were given life; it is your duty (and also your entitlement as a human being) to find something beautiful within life, no matter how slight.
- Elizabeth Gilbert
